Perfect Square
404433094916251229438832818360869232780287875625 is a perfect square (635950544394964119476275 × 635950544394964119476275)
404433094916251229438832818360869232780287875625 is a perfect square (635950544394964119476275 × 635950544394964119476275)
404433094916251229438832818360869232780287875625 is odd
Previous odd number is 404433094916251229438832818360869232780287875623
Next odd number is 404433094916251229438832818360869232780287875627
100011011010111011010000011110111100110001010010101011101001000100111000101110001001101110000100011000101111010110111111001100111101000000011110001101000101001
66151555477090974938258139807988881921838475120034312410267120756894430423417403254947939241507451415597962257740197922966665922476025634765625
163566128263537476046018396405025364175410738056407222361580796040938119940259708847375469140625